Abstract
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) plays a significant role in shaping the economic landscape of developing countries. This thesis investigates the impact of FDI on economic growth in developing countries, focusing on the various channels through which FDI influences economic development. The study examines the theoretical framework underpinning FDI and economic growth, reviews relevant literature on the subject, and presents empirical evidence to support the analysis. The introduction provides a comprehensive overview of the research topic, highlighting the importance of FDI in driving economic growth and development in developing countries. The background of the study sets the context for the research, outlining the historical trends and patterns of FDI inflows into developing countries. The problem statement identifies the gaps in existing literature and justifies the need for further research on the topic. The objectives of the study are clearly defined to guide the research process, while the limitations and scope of the study delineate the boundaries within which the research will be conducted. The significance of the study is underscored by its potential to contribute to the existing body of knowledge on FDI and economic growth in developing countries. The structure of the thesis is outlined to provide a roadmap for the reader, detailing the organization of chapters and key sections. Definitions of key terms are provided to ensure clarity and understanding of the concepts discussed throughout the thesis. The literature review chapter critically examines existing studies on FDI and economic growth, highlighting the key theories, empirical findings, and methodological approaches used in previous research. The review covers a range of topics, including the impact of FDI on productivity, technology transfer, human capital development, and export growth in developing countries. The research methodology chapter outlines the research design, data sources, sampling techniques, and analytical methods used in the study. The chapter discusses the rationale behind the chosen methodology and justifies its suitability for addressing the research questions. Data collection procedures and analysis techniques are described in detail to ensure transparency and replicability of the study. The discussion of findings chapter presents the results of the empirical analysis, examining the relationship between FDI inflows and economic growth in developing countries. The findings are interpreted in light of the theoretical framework and existing literature, highlighting the key implications for policy and practice. The chapter also discusses the limitations of the study and suggests avenues for future research. In conclusion, this thesis sheds light on the complex relationship between FDI and economic growth in developing countries, providing valuable insights for policymakers, investors, and researchers. The study contributes to a better understanding of the mechanisms through which FDI influences economic development and offers practical recommendations for enhancing the positive impact of FDI on economic growth in developing countries.
